I. What is YouTube CPM?

1.1 Definition of CPM

CPM, or Cost Per Mille, refers to the amount advertisers pay for every 1,000 ad displays.YouTube Creators are paid a cut based on CPM and number of views. Generally speaking, the higher the CPM, the higher the creator's share of the ad.

1.2 Difference between CPM and RPM

RPM (Revenue Per Mille), on the other hand, is the creator's actual revenue per 1,000 views, calculated as:

RPM = (Total Revenue / Total Views) x 1000

RPM includes revenue streams such as ad revenue, channel memberships, and YouTube Premium, while CPM is only for ad display costs.

Second, the key factors affecting YouTube CPM

2.1 Location of the audience

Advertisers' budgets vary by country or region. Typically, CPMs are higher in the United States, Canada, Australia, and parts of Europe, while CPMs are lower in South Asia, Southeast Asia, and Latin America.

For example, the same 100,000 views may generate $300 in ad share if the audience is concentrated in the US, but only $50-100 if the audience is concentrated in India.

2.2 Video Content Types

YouTube ad delivery matches advertisers based on content topics. Ads in business, finance, technology, education, etc. have higher CPMs because advertisers in these fields are willing to pay more for precise placement; CPMs in entertainment, funny, vlogs, etc. are relatively low.

2.3 Video duration

In general, videos longer than 8 minutes can insert multiple interstitial ads, which can significantly increase revenue per play. Shorter videos or videos less than 8 minutes long can only display front patches or a small number of display ads.

2.4 Seasonal factors

Ad budgets fluctuate at different times of the year. The fourth quarter (October-December) typically has the highest CPMs, as brands ramp up during the Black Friday and Christmas shopping seasons, while the first quarter (January-March) has reduced budgets and the lowest CPMs.

2.5 Spectator equipment

Users who watch YouTube videos on their computers see more ads and at a higher price per unit, while mobile users, though large in number, have a slightly lower CPM.

2.6 Channel Performance and Viewer Stickiness

YouTube prefers to place high-value ads on premium channels. If your channel has a high number of watch hours, completion rates, and interactions, theYouTube The system will assume that your audience segment is of high value and the matching ads will have a higher CPM.

2.7 Types of advertising

  • Display Ads: Usually appears next to the video or in the testimonials section and has a low CPM.
  • Overlay Ads: Translucent ads below the video with average CPM.
  • Skippable Ads (Splice Ads): Skippable ads, slightly higher CPM.
  • Non-skippable Ads (NSAs): Higher CPM, but it affects the viewer experience.
  • Bumper Ads (6-second non-skippable ads): CPMs are also higher and are often used for brand exposure.

Third, how to improve YouTube CPM?

Image[4]-YouTube Ad Share Revealed: Key Factors Affecting CPM

3.1 Optimizing content areas

specialize in CPM Higher content types, such as financial management, tech reviews, business operations, and software tutorials, help attract high-value ads.

3.2 Enhancement of the geographical quality of the audience

Overall CPM will be significantly increased by engaging audiences from the U.S., Canada, Australia, and Europe through English-language content.

3.3 Increase in video duration

For videos longer than 8 minutes, inserting interstitials can increase the total advertising revenue of a single video.

3.4 Enhance overall channel performance

Focus on content quality and viewer engagement, such as boosting click-through rates, watch lengths, and completion rates, and let YouTube rate your channel as more commercially viable.

3.5 Focus on timing of release

Rationalizing the timing of video releases and ramping up output in quarters with ample ad budgets (especially Q4) can help boost CPM.
